shaky
/ˈʃeɪkɪ/adjective
1shakier, shakiest
shaking or trembling摇动的; 颤抖的:she managed a shaky laugh.
她勉力笑了笑, 笑声带着点颤抖。
1.1
- unstable because of poor construction or heavy use不平稳的, 摇晃的:
a cracked, dangerously shaky table.
一张开裂的、摇摇晃晃随时要倒的桌子。
1.2
- not safe or reliable; liable to fail or falter不安全的; 不可靠的; 成问题的:
thoroughly shaky evidence
完全站不住脚的证据
after a shaky start the Scottish team made superb efforts.
苏格兰队开场发挥不稳定, 但后来有上佳表现。
